Subject: [-mm patch 0/5] SharpSL: Prepare drivers and add new ARM PXA machines Spitz and Borzoi
Date: Tue, 06 Sep 2005 12:53:45 +0100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1126007626.8338.125.camel@localhost.localdomain> (raw)
Sharp's newer range of Zaurus clamshell handhelds, the cxx00's are
similar to the c7x0 series yet different. This patch series abstracts
the differences and generates a set of common drivers that support both
series of devices. It then adds machine support for Spitz (SL-C3000) and
Borzoi (SL-C3100). Hooks for Akita (SL-C1000) differences are also
added. The I2C driver for its IO expander is the only missing piece.
This series of patches is heavily based on the corgi patches already in
-mm so its being submitted to Andrew. The patches have been mentioned on
linux-arm-kernel and no objections were raised.
I hope to follow this series with a spitz keyboard driver (the only
driver not shared with the c7x0) and a battery+power management driver
for both corgi and spitz models within a few days.
USB Host and MTD support for Spitz are being dealt with through the
subsystem maintainers.
